What is the “illinois equine research assessment”?
Every time i buy a bag of feed, i’m charged $.05 per bag of feed, and next to it, it says “illinois equine research assessment”. i keep forgetting to ask what it is i’m being charged for. not that i care, it’s 5 cents, i’m just curious what it is. i tried looking it up online, but i got the bill itself…which i don’t understand. from what i understood, it’s assuming i have a horse, so they’re charging me money, and that money goes to equine research…is this correct?
Your Equine Research & Promotion Dollars at Work
From roofs to fences, from pastures to trails, from first responders to Ph.D’s, your equine checkoff dollars are working hard in Illinois. Most notably, an $8,700 grant to the Shawnee Trails Conservancy from the EPB, turned into $128,000 when it was used to obtain matching funds from the Recreation Trails Program, created through the National Recreation Fund Act. The grant-funded trail work will be designed to protect sensitive natural resources, while providing a well-maintained equestrian trail through some of the most visited areas of the Shawnee National Forest.
A grant to Rainbow Riders Therapeutic Riding Center in Monmouth, IL also helped Western Illinois University student Becky Hoelscher make the grade in her social work policy course. As a part of their coursework, students were asked to write a grant proposal. “My first thought was to compose a proposal for Rainbow Riders, Hoelscher said. “I figured this assignment would be a perfect opportunity for another way for me to help,” she said.
Rainbow Riders provides an excellent volunteer opportunity for those who love to help and work with people and horses, according to Hoelscher. “It’s an amazing place, and it really does provide hope and offer a beautiful and therapeutic experience for the children and their families,” she said.
Thanks in part to Becky’s efforts, the Rainbow Riders horses have a new roof over their barn.
All other projects funded by the EPB are either completed or progressing well. Illinois horse owners will benefit in many ways, either by having improved facilities in which to show and ride, or by having better prepared first responders at an accident scene. Education and research are also key areas funded by the EPB, and the 2009 grants supported pasture management seminars as well as exploring equine arthritis therapies.
Proposals for grants to be awarded at the 21st annual Illinois Horse Fair will be accepted through January 15, 2010. A detailed research application is available (as well as a shorter project application) at www.HorsemensCouncil.org or from the EPB administrative office.
